You are on page 1of 6

Reto TCP

Nombre: Antonio Manuel Jaramillo Valladares


Fecha: 17 de diciembre de 2015.
Pregunta 1. Cul es la direccin IP y el nmero de puerto TCP
utilizado por el equipo cliente (fuente) que est transfiriendo el
archivo a gaia.cs.umass.edu? (Sugerencia: Para responder a esta
pregunta es probablemente ms fcil para seleccionar un mensaje
HTTP y explorar los detalles del paquete TCP usado para llevar este
mensaje HTTP, utilizando los "Detalles del encabezado del paquete
seleccionado de la ventana").

Fuente
IP direccion: 172.17.109.191
TCP Numero de Puerto: 59169
Pregunta 2. Cul es la direccin IP de gaia.cs.umass.edu? Sobre
qu nmero de puerto es el envo y la recepcin de los segmentos
TCP para esta conexin?

Destino
IP direccion: 128.119.245.12
TCP Numero de Puerto: 80
Pregunta 3. Cul es el nmero de secuencia del segmento TCP SYN
que se utiliza para iniciar la conexin TCP entre el equipo cliente y
gaia.cs.umass.edu? Lo que est en el segmento que identifica el
segmento como un segmento SYN?

El nmero de secuencia del segmento SYN es 448. Haciendo clic en el campo


de etiquetas de Ethereal revela los detalles de todos los campos de indicador.
Observe que el flag SYN para este segmento se ha establecido en 1, lo que
significa que este segmento es un segmento SYN.
Pregunta 4. Cul es el nmero de secuencia del segmento enviado
por gaia.cs.umass.edu SYNACK al equipo cliente en respuesta a la

SYN? Cul es el valor del campo de acuse de recibo en el segmento


SYNACK? Cmo hizo gaia.cs.umass.edu determinar ese valor? Qu
es en el segmento que identifica el segmento como SYNACK
segmento?

Secuencia igual a 0
El segmento SYN puedo estar dado entre los valores de 1( . ...1.
= Syn:SET)

Pregunta 5. Cul es el nmero de secuencia del segmento ACK


enviados por el equipo cliente en respuesta a la SYNACK? Cul es
el valor del reconocimiento presentada en este segmento ACK?
Este segmento no contiene ningn dato? Qu es en el segmento
que identifica a este segmento como un segmento ACK?
El nmero de secuencia: nmero Agradecimientos: 1 (nmero ACK relativa)
valor del campo RECONOCIMIENTO es 1
gaia.cs.umass.edu determin que el valor aadiendo 1 al nmero de secuencia del
segmento de anterior.
Este segmento se identifica como un reconocimiento segmento SYNACK y los bits
SYN son ambos set.

Pregunta 6. Cul es el nmero de secuencia del segmento TCP que


contenga el comando HTTP POST? Tenga en cuenta que para
encontrar el comando POST, tendrs que excavar en el campo de
contenido del paquete en la parte inferior de la ventana de
Ethereal, buscando un segmento con un "poste" dentro de su
campo de datos.

Pregunta 7. Considerar el segmento TCP que contenga el POST de


HTTP como el primer segmento de la conexin TCP. Cules son los
nmeros de secuencia de los primeros seis segmentos en la
conexin TCP (incluyendo el segmento que contiene el POST de
HTTP) enviados desde el cliente al servidor web (no consideran los
asentimientos recibidos desde el servidor como parte de estos seis
segmentos)? A qu hora era cada segmento enviado? Cuando fue el
ACK para cada segmento recibido? Dada la diferencia entre cada

segmento TCP cuando fue enviado, y cuando se ha recibido un


acuse de recibo, cul es el valor de RTT para cada uno de los seis
segmentos? Cul es el valor EstimatedRTT (consulte la pgina 237
en el texto, Seccin 3.5.3) tras la recepcin de cada ACK?
Supongamos que el valor de la EstimatedRTT es igual a la
medidaSampleRTT RTT () para el primer segmento y, a
continuacin, se calcula mediante la ecuacin EstimatedRTT en la
pgina 237 para todos los segmentos siguientes. Establecer a
0.125.
Nota: Wireshark tiene una caracterstica que le permite trazar la
RTT para cada uno de los TCP Segmentos enviados. Seleccione un
segmento TCP en el "listado de paquetes capturados" ventana que
Se enva desde el cliente al servidor gaia.cs.umass.edu. A
continuacin,
seleccione:
Estadsticas>TCP Stream Grfico>Grfico de tiempo de ida y vuelta.

Los detalles de los seis primeros segmentos y los asentimientos


correspondientes son proporcionados a continuacin, junto con el clculo de
la EstimatedRTT:
No.
1
2
3
4
5
6

Nmero
secuencia
488
493
499
520
543
560

deLongitud
(en
243
244
248
254
259
265

Tiempo

Muestra

Estimado

ACK

RTT

RTT

0.2334530
0.420056
0.575042
0.604587
0.65789
0.902455

0.02746
0.030256
0.03655
0.0458
0.060245
0.07845

0.02746
0.028472
0.03512
0.04245
0.058951
0.079454

Pregunta 8. Cul es la longitud de cada uno de los seis primeros


segmentos TCP?
Consulta en la tabla anterior.
Pregunta 9. Cul es la cantidad mnima de espacio de bfer
disponible anunciados en el receptor para el rastreo completo? La
falta de espacio en bfer del receptor nunca acelere el remitente?
Longitud del primer segmento TCP (contiene la HTTP POST): 32 bytes
Longitud de cada uno de los otros cinco segmentos TCP: 100 bytes (MSS)
Pregunta 10. Hay algn segmentos retransmitidos en el archivo de
rastreo? Qu hizo usted comprobar (en la traza) para responder a
esta pregunta?
Se puede ver en la tabla

Pregunta 11. Qu cantidad de datos el receptor suele reconocer en


un asentimiento? Puede determinar los casos en los que el receptor
est ACKing cada otro segmento recibido (vase el cuadro 3.2 de la
pgina 245 en el texto, Seccin 3.5.4).

Pregunta 12. Cul es el rendimiento (bytes transferidos por unidad


de tiempo) para el protocolo TCP Conexin? Explicar cmo se
calcula este valor.

You might also like